A vibrant discussion is heating up on various forums as individuals express their thoughts on astral projection. The core debate emphasizes how awareness plays a crucial role in consciously accessing this practice.
Participants argue that awareness is critical for anyone wanting to consciously astral project. One commenter noted, "Asking how do I astral project is like asking how do I breathe our soul explores daily while we sleep." This sentiment resonates with many who believe that daily existence is a form of projection.
"Your entire existence is a projection" - a user reflects on the nature of consciousness.
Interestingly, some bring up mental challenges like ADHD that hinder maintaining awareness. For instance, one person shared, "It's such a chore for me to maintain awareness my brain is always taking off on a tangent." This highlights the diverse struggles individuals face in accessing deeper states of consciousness.
Another aspect of the conversation revolves around the misconception that people are only their bodies. "Most of us believe we are the body not much changes until we remember we are awareness, too," a person commented, urging a shift in perception.
Several participants reference Thomas Campbell's theory of consciousness, suggesting that the awareness perspective could unify various understandings. It seems many are searching for ways to remember this truth and explore their spiritual landscapes more deeply.
